Should I Rent A Car in Zanzibar
If you intend to travel the island and visit various tourist spots instead of predominantly remaining at the beach or in Stone Town, renting a car is unequivocally advisable.
If your sole intention in Zanzibar is to unwind at the beach, you may just depend on taxis for transportation between the airport and the beach. Driving can be cumbersome and is only advantageous if one seeks to venture further inland.
Should you choose to rent a vehicle, ensure you possess proficient driving skills, as the roads in Zanzibar are substandard, with certain regions, such as Nungwi, being unpaved.
They drive on the left, which can be disorienting for novices; so, it is advisable to take a few moments to acclimatise to the reversed orientation. If you have driven in developing nations such as Thailand previously, you should manage well in Zanzibar.
In summary, if you intend to spend a minimum of two days touring the inland tourist destinations, renting a car in Zanzibar will undoubtedly provide excellent value for your investment. If your sole intention is to spend time at the beach, then the inconvenience is, in my view, unwarranted.
How Much To Rent A Car in Zanzibar
The cost of car rental in Zanzibar varies from 35 USD to 100 USD per day, contingent upon the vehicle and the desired level of comfort. The most economical choice is a Toyota RAV4-3 SPECIAL, a 3-door 4WD vehicle equipped with air conditioning, ideal for individual travellers and couples alike.
For $40 to $45 USD daily, you can receive a newer model of the Toyota RAV4, offering increased room, ideal for groups beyond two individuals. For $100 USD daily, you will receive a Toyota Land Cruiser accommodating up to 7 passengers in comfort.
Renting a car in Zanzibar necessitates an additional payment of 10 USD for a temporary local driving licence, which must be presented if stopped by traffic authorities while operating the vehicle.
Your total expenditure will range from approximately 35 to 100 USD per day, contingent upon your vehicle selection, in addition to a fee of 10 USD for a local driving licence, and that concludes the costs.
